Types of Maternity Items Covered by Insurance

When it comes to maternity insurance coverage, there are several categories of items and services that may be included in a typical plan. These can range from medical services related to prenatal care, diagnostic tests, and screenings, to prescription medications specifically for pregnancy-related conditions. Additionally, some insurance policies may also cover maternity wear, compression garments, breastfeeding supplies, and maternity support belts and bands.

How to Check Insurance Coverage for Maternity Items

To determine the extent of coverage for maternity items under a particular insurance plan, individuals can take several steps. This includes contacting their insurance provider to inquire about specific benefits, reviewing detailed plan documents to understand the scope of coverage, and seeking pre-approval for maternity expenses to avoid unexpected costs.

Tips for Maximizing Insurance Coverage for Maternity Items

Maximizing insurance coverage for maternity items involves being proactive and knowledgeable about the terms of a policy. Keeping detailed records of expenses, understanding co-pays and deductibles, using in-network providers whenever possible, and advocating for coverage of essential maternity items can help individuals make the most of their insurance benefits.
